Unique Southwestern Decor
Experience the charm of Santa Fe at Old Santa Fe Inn with its distinctive Southwestern décor that immerses you in the local culture from the moment you arrive. Each air-conditioned room offers a blend of modern amenities and traditional accents, providing a comfortable and authentic stay.
Convenient Amenities
Enjoy the convenience of free WiFi, a work desk, flat-screen cable TV, and an iPod docking station in every room. With additional features like a microwave, small refrigerator, and en suite bathroom, your comfort is ensured throughout your stay.
Central Location
Situated just minutes away from iconic attractions such as La Fonda on the Plaza, Santa Fe Plaza, and Loretto Chapel, Old Santa Fe Inn offers easy access to the best of the city. Explore the vibrant surroundings and return to the hotel's welcoming atmosphere.

The Pet fee is $40Guests are required to show a photo ID and credit card upon check-in. Please note that all Special Requests are subject to availability and additional charges may apply.
A deposit may be required at the property.
Children of any age are allowed.
Children up to and including 2 years old stay for free when using an available cot.
Children up to and including 17 years old stay for free when using an existing bed.
People no matter the age stay for free when using an available extra bed.
Any type of extra bed or child's cot/crib is upon request and needs to be confirmed by management.
Pets are allowed. Charges may be applicable.
WiFi is available in the hotel rooms and is free of charge.
Private parking is possible on site (reservation is not needed) and charges may be applicable.
